Education and Achievements

Adam Stensland laid the foundation for his impactful career through rigorous academic training. He earned a Bachelor's Degree from the esteemed Georgia Institute of Technology, where he majored in Management, Accounting, and Industrial/Organizational Psychology. This multidisciplinary degree equips him with a robust understanding of how people operate within organizations, as well as the financial acumen necessary for effective leadership and decision-making.

To further enhance his managerial skills and leadership capabilities, Adam completed an Executive Certificate in Management & Leadership at the University of Notre Dame's Mendoza College of Business. Career at PwC

Adam's professional journey has predominantly unfolded at PwC, where he has held various influential roles that showcase his evolving expertise and commitment to employee transformation.

  • Director: As a Director at PwC, Adam’s leadership has positively impacted teams and projects, facilitating effective collaboration and innovative solutions tailored to client needs.
  • Business, Experience, Technology (BXT) Coach: In this pivotal role, Adam coached cross-functional teams to harmoniously align business objectives with employee experiences, emphasizing the need for adaptability in an ever-changing business landscape.
  • Senior Manager, HR Tech Strategy: His position as Senior Manager allowed him to develop forward-thinking technology strategies, optimizing human resources practices through enhanced technological tools and solutions.
  • Manager, HR Transformation: Adam's efforts in HR Transformation were focused on redefining how organizations interact with their employees, emphasizing a more strategic and thoughtful approach to human resources.
  • Senior Associate: As a Senior Associate, he was involved in numerous projects that highlighted his ability to strategize and implement innovative solutions within diverse teams.
  • Experienced Associate: Adam began his PwC journey as an Experienced Associate, grounding himself in the essential functions that would elevate his career and future initiatives.

Before joining PwC, Adam's career began at Unilever, where he served as a Supply Chain Co-Op in Contract Manufacturing. This early experience laid the groundwork for his understanding of supply chain dynamics and the importance of efficient processes in business operations.
